Inkjet vs. Darkroom Prints: A Detailed Comparison

The world of photographic printing offers various options, each with its own set of advantages and disadvantages. Among the most popular methods are inkjet and darkroom prints. Understanding the nuances of both is crucial for photographers and enthusiasts alike. This article provides a comprehensive comparison of inkjet vs. darkroom prints, covering aspects like image quality, archival properties, cost, and environmental impact to help you make an informed decision.

Image Quality

Image quality is often the primary concern when choosing a printing method. Both inkjet and darkroom prints can produce stunning results, but they achieve them through different means.

Inkjet Prints

Inkjet prints, also known as giclée prints, utilize a digital process. Tiny droplets of ink are sprayed onto the paper, creating a continuous tone image. This allows for incredible detail and smooth gradations.

  • High resolution and sharpness.
  • Excellent color accuracy and consistency.
  • Wide tonal range and smooth transitions.

Inkjet technology allows for precise control over color and density, resulting in highly accurate reproductions of digital images. The use of archival-quality inks and papers further enhances the longevity and vibrancy of these prints.

Darkroom Prints

Darkroom prints, on the other hand, are created using traditional photographic methods. A negative is projected onto light-sensitive paper, which is then developed in a series of chemical baths.

  • Unique aesthetic with a characteristic grain and tonality.
  • Rich blacks and subtle highlights.
  • Tactile quality and a sense of depth.

The darkroom process offers a level of artistic control that is difficult to replicate digitally. Skilled printers can manipulate the image during development, dodging and burning areas to achieve specific effects. The resulting prints often have a unique and timeless quality.

Archival Properties

The archival properties of a print refer to its ability to resist fading, discoloration, and deterioration over time. This is a crucial consideration for preserving valuable photographs.

Inkjet Prints

The archival quality of inkjet prints depends heavily on the inks and papers used. Pigment-based inks are generally more fade-resistant than dye-based inks. Archival-quality papers are acid-free and lignin-free, preventing them from yellowing or becoming brittle over time.

  • Pigment-based inks offer excellent fade resistance.
  • Archival-quality papers ensure longevity.
  • Proper storage and handling are essential for maximizing lifespan.

When using high-quality materials and proper storage techniques, inkjet prints can last for over 100 years without significant degradation. This makes them a suitable choice for creating heirloom-quality prints.

Darkroom Prints

The archival quality of darkroom prints is influenced by the paper, chemicals, and processing techniques used. Fiber-based papers are generally more archival than resin-coated (RC) papers. Proper washing is crucial for removing residual chemicals that can cause deterioration.

  • Fiber-based papers offer superior archival properties.
  • Thorough washing is essential for removing residual chemicals.
  • Toning can enhance archival stability.

Well-processed darkroom prints on fiber-based paper can also last for over 100 years. However, they are more susceptible to damage from improper handling and storage compared to some inkjet prints.

Cost

The cost of printing is a significant factor for many photographers. Both inkjet and darkroom printing involve various expenses, but the overall cost can vary depending on the scale and quality of the work.

Inkjet Prints

The initial investment in inkjet printing can be substantial, including the cost of a high-quality printer, inks, and papers. However, the cost per print can be relatively low, especially for larger print runs.

  • High initial investment in equipment.
  • Ongoing costs for inks and papers.
  • Cost per print decreases with larger print runs.

Inkjet printing is often more cost-effective for photographers who produce a large volume of prints or require consistent results across multiple prints.

Darkroom Prints

Darkroom printing also requires an initial investment in equipment, including an enlarger, darkroom supplies, and chemicals. The cost per print can be higher than inkjet printing, especially for smaller print runs.

  • Initial investment in darkroom equipment and supplies.
  • Ongoing costs for papers and chemicals.
  • Cost per print can be higher, especially for smaller print runs.

Darkroom printing can be more expensive due to the hands-on nature of the process and the cost of materials. However, some photographers find that the unique aesthetic and artistic control offered by darkroom printing justify the higher cost.

Environmental Impact

The environmental impact of printing is an increasingly important consideration. Both inkjet and darkroom printing have environmental consequences, but they differ in their nature.

Inkjet Prints

Inkjet printing can generate waste in the form of ink cartridges and paper scraps. Some inks contain volatile organic compounds (VOCs) that can contribute to air pollution. However, many manufacturers are now offering more environmentally friendly inks and recycling programs for cartridges.

  • Waste from ink cartridges and paper scraps.
  • Potential VOC emissions from some inks.
  • Recycling programs and eco-friendly inks are available.

Choosing environmentally friendly inks and papers, and participating in recycling programs can help minimize the environmental impact of inkjet printing.

Darkroom Prints

Darkroom printing involves the use of chemicals that can be harmful to the environment. These chemicals must be disposed of properly to prevent water pollution. The process also consumes water and energy.

  • Use of potentially harmful chemicals.
  • Proper disposal of chemicals is essential.
  • Consumption of water and energy.

Proper handling and disposal of chemicals, as well as water conservation efforts, can help reduce the environmental impact of darkroom printing.

Process and Workflow

The process and workflow involved in each printing method differ significantly, impacting the time, skill, and equipment required.

Inkjet Prints

Inkjet printing involves a digital workflow. Images are captured or scanned, processed in software, and then printed using an inkjet printer. The process is relatively straightforward and can be automated to a large extent.

  • Digital workflow: capture, process, print.
  • Relatively straightforward and automated.
  • Requires knowledge of digital image processing software.

Inkjet printing is well-suited for photographers who prefer a digital workflow and require consistent results.

Darkroom Prints

Darkroom printing is a more hands-on process. It involves working in a darkroom, projecting a negative onto light-sensitive paper, and developing the print in a series of chemical baths. The process requires skill and experience.

  • Hands-on process in a darkroom.
  • Requires skill and experience.
  • Offers a high degree of artistic control.

Darkroom printing appeals to photographers who enjoy the tactile nature of the process and value the artistic control it offers.

Skill and Expertise Required

The level of skill and expertise needed for each printing method varies, influencing the learning curve and the potential for achieving high-quality results.

Inkjet Prints

While inkjet printing can be automated to a degree, achieving truly exceptional results requires a solid understanding of color management, printer settings, and paper profiles. Mastering these elements allows for precise control over the final print.

  • Understanding of color management principles.
  • Knowledge of printer settings and paper profiles.
  • Ability to calibrate and maintain the printer.

With dedication and practice, photographers can develop the skills necessary to produce stunning inkjet prints that accurately reflect their artistic vision.

Darkroom Prints

Darkroom printing demands a deep understanding of photographic chemistry, exposure techniques, and dodging and burning methods. Mastering these skills takes time and practice, but the rewards are well worth the effort. Skilled darkroom printers can create prints with exceptional tonal range, contrast, and depth.

  • Knowledge of photographic chemistry and processes.
  • Mastery of exposure and development techniques.
  • Ability to manipulate the image through dodging and burning.

The darkroom is a laboratory where photographers can experiment and push the boundaries of their craft, creating prints that are both technically proficient and artistically expressive.

Frequently Asked Questions

What are the main differences between inkjet and darkroom prints?

Inkjet prints are created digitally using ink, while darkroom prints are created using traditional photographic methods and chemicals. Inkjet offers more consistent results and digital workflow integration, while darkroom provides a unique aesthetic and hands-on artistic control.

Which type of print is more archival?

Both inkjet and darkroom prints can be highly archival, but it depends on the materials and processes used. Pigment-based inkjet prints on archival-quality paper and well-processed fiber-based darkroom prints can both last for over 100 years.

Which printing method is more cost-effective?

Inkjet printing is often more cost-effective for larger print runs due to the lower cost per print. Darkroom printing can be more expensive, especially for smaller print runs, due to the cost of materials and the hands-on nature of the process.

Which printing method is better for the environment?

Both methods have environmental impacts. Inkjet printing generates waste from ink cartridges and paper scraps, while darkroom printing involves the use of potentially harmful chemicals. Choosing environmentally friendly inks and papers for inkjet, and properly disposing of chemicals in darkroom printing can help minimize the impact.

Do I need special software for inkjet printing?

Yes, you’ll typically need image editing software like Adobe Photoshop or GIMP to process your images before printing. These programs allow you to adjust color, contrast, and sharpness, and prepare the file for optimal printing results. Printer-specific software can also help with color management.

Is one method more difficult to learn than the other?

Both methods have their own learning curves. Darkroom printing often requires a longer initial learning period due to the hands-on nature and chemical processes involved. Inkjet printing, while seemingly simpler, requires a good understanding of digital image processing and color management to achieve optimal results.
